Meeting Point and Directions
Finding the meeting point for the scenic sailboat tour in Barcelona is a breeze, and it sets the stage for an unforgettable experience.
Guests simply need to head to Mooring 1416, Moll de la Marina 10, right at Port Olímpic. It’s nestled between the iconic Hotel Arts and Torre Mapfre, making it easy to spot.
Arriving ten minutes early is a smart move—no one wants to miss the boat, especially with the salty breeze and stunning views waiting!
For those who prefer digital navigation, a quick click on Google Maps gets them there effortlessly.

Customer Reviews and Ratings
Many guests have raved about their experiences on the scenic sailboat tour in Barcelona, highlighting the friendly atmosphere and the expert guidance of the skipper.
With an overall rating of 4.6/5, it’s clear that many found joy in this unique adventure. Here are some key takeaways from the reviews:
- Transportation: Rated 4.9/5, nearly everyone appreciated the easy access to the boat.
- Value for Money: Scoring 4.3/5, many felt the experience was worth every penny.
- Friendly Skipper: Reviewers frequently mentioned the skipper’s warmth and expertise.
- Cozy Atmosphere: Guests enjoyed the intimate setting, though some noted space concerns during rough seas.
